Speaking in Green Bay, Wisconsin, on September 19, Republican presidential candidate John McCain said he would create a new federal agency, called the Mortgage and Financial Institutions Trust (MFI), which would work to head off the financial crisis. "The underlying principle of the MFI or any approach considered by Congress should be to keep people in their homes and safeguard the life savings of all Americans by protecting our financial system and capital markets," McCain said according to CNN.
CNN also reported that during his speech, McCain blamed the financial crisis on "the corruption and manipulation of our home mortgage system," claiming the culprits were Fannie Mae, Freddie Mac, Congress, and Senator Barack Obama. Freddie and Fannie, said McCain, "led our housing system down a path where quick profit was placed before sound finance."
